the ideas WAS, to shrink a bottle around a plaster mold, like shrink tube.
It is almost ashaming to admit I'm an engineer, but I did not think about the fact that the material will of course shrink to the shortest distance between 2 end points of an inner angle, like between side windows and side of the body. I had read the bottle method on some German site and though wow that is cool without thinking it through.
I just did a first off with a 1 gallon water bottle, and the results are not close to what I was hoping for.
Of course the bottle was ribbed, and all the other stuff I've read were using 3l straight cola bottles, so that might be a factor.
